Step by Step Program Foundation/Bulgaria is a non-governmental organization working in the field of the Bulgarian education since 1994.
Vision
Quality education for the XXI century
Mission
As an educational model, the Step by Step Program - Bulgaria spreads ideas concerning the implementation of the following activities through using democratic principles for education:
- Offering educational technologies and strategies connected with interactive teaching methods and organization of the school environment;
- Monitoring, evaluation and research of educational projects;
- Developing specific projects in the field of permanent education as well as training and re-training teachers.
Connected to this, the Step by Step Program Foundation conducts the following projects:
- Infant and Toddler Groups Project
- Preschool Project
- Primary School Project
- Higher Education Project
- Children with Special Educational Needs Project
- Boards of School Trustees Project
- Municipality - Model Site Project
- Special Schools Project
